Global Head of Insight Generation and AI Adoption, MD - State Street Investment Management (Boston)

Full-time

CFA Institute

State Street Investment Management (SSIM) – formerly State Street Global Advisors (SSGA) – is seeking an accomplished senior leader to serve as the Global Head of Insight Generation and AI Adoption . This Managing Director role is critical to shaping, driving, and executing the AI strategy that underpins the Investment Management division’s transformation.

As a strategic partner to the Global Head of Data, Analytics, and AI Services (DAAIS) , you will oversee AI services supporting the COO organization across SSIM globally. You will lead global teams responsible for data science R&D, AI/ML/DL modeling, Generative AI, Agentic AI, and enterprise‑scale AI platforms – ensuring alignment with GTS standards and the target AI ecosystem blueprint.

This is a senior global role requiring deep expertise in AI architecture, enterprise platforms, AI governance, and modern ML/GenAI/Agentic AI development, combined with significant leadership experience in asset management.

Key Responsibilities

Leadership & Strategy

  • Support SSIM’s AI vision and strategy; lead end‑to‑end implementation of data science capabilities, AI frameworks, tooling, and vendor adoption across all business lines.
  • Lead and mentor high‑performing AI teams across the US, China, and India – building a culture grounded in deep AI expertise and accountability (not traditional staff‑augmentation models).
  • Define SSIM’s AI architecture, establish enterprise AI standards, and guide implementation and governance practices.
  • Ensure a modular, scalable, and reusable AI architecture to eliminate siloed development and accelerate time to market.
  • Champion engineering excellence, technical rigor, and innovation across the organization.

Engineering Excellence

  • Innovation & Best Practices : Evaluate, adopt, and standardize cutting‑edge AI capabilities – including Agentic AI, Generative AI, and foundational AI/ML/DL models.
  • Quality & Performance : Ensure solutions meet the highest engineering standards through code reviews, testing frameworks, and adherence to industry guidelines.
  • Collaboration & Mentorship : Build a collaborative engineering community focused on continuous learning, knowledge sharing, and professional development.
  • Scalability & Resilience : Architect systems capable of supporting global business workloads with strong reliability and performance characteristics.
  • Security & Compliance : Uphold stringent risk, security, and regulatory requirements; ensure robust data protection and governance.

Execution & Oversight

  • Lead global AI core teams with a focus on innovation, delivery excellence, and operating leverage.
  • Manage major vendor relationships – including AI platform providers and service partners – ensuring strong integration, service quality, and contractual outcomes.
  • Oversee the full AI/ML model lifecycle from ideation to production deployment across a diverse set of use cases and global users.

Qualifications

  • Master’s degree required (Computer Science, Financial Mathematics, or related field); PhD preferred.
  • 15+ years in the asset management industry, with deep knowledge of asset management, public and private markets, and distribution/sales.
  • 10+ years hands‑on AI experience with a strong track record delivering AI solutions and platforms.
  • Proven experience leading global technology organizations across product, data, AI, and engineering domains, with strong delivery execution.
  • Strong understanding of the AI vendor landscape and demonstrated experience adopting vendor products and open‑source frameworks to improve scale and growth.
  • Exceptional leadership, stakeholder management, communication, and relationship‑building sk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to translate complex business needs into scalable, user‑centric technology solutions.
  • Fluent in English; highly detail‑oriented, results‑driven, candid, and execution‑focused.

Highly Preferred

  • Prior data science development and management experience in a large financial institution.
  • CFA or equivalent credential.

Salary Range

$170,000 – $282,500 Annual (range quoted above applies to the role in the primary location specified).

Benefits

Employees are eligible to participate in State Street’s comprehensive benefits program, which includes: retirement savings plan (401K) with company match; insurance coverage including basic life, medical, dental, vision, long‑term disability, and other optional additional coverages; paid‑time off including vacation, sick leave, short‑term disability, and family care responsibilities; access to our Employee Assistance Program; incentive compensation including eligibility for annual performance‑based awards (excluding certain sales roles subject to sales incentive plans); and, eligibility for certain tax‑advantaged savings plans.
